BETHANY A. ROMANEK Education Writer
WEST LIBERTY - When looking back on his first full year leading West Liberty State College, President Robin Capehart attributes love for the institution as the reason for his successful first term.
"It was a very good year," Capehart said. "We have had a good year and the reason has been because all of the people at this school the faculty, the staff, the students, the benefactors all truly love this school and the opportunity it's providing them now, and the opportunity it's provided them in the past. They are excited about moving forward into university status. It's been such a good year."
A former gubernatorial candidate, Capehart succeeds Richard Owens who resigned from the president's post in 2005. John McCullough served as West Liberty's interim president following Owens' resignation.
Capehart began his role as the 33rd president of the college last July, with plans to utilize his political roots and a goal of acquainting himself with WLSC campus life.
Over the past year, Capehart has taken several steps to move West Liberty from college to university status. The West Liberty State College Board of Governors approved changing the intuition's name to West Liberty University - once all of the requirements are met.
